Overview

The University of Ottawa has a bicameral governance structure, that is, two representative assemblies. One is the Senate and the other, the Board of Governors. Each body has a specific jurisdiction, and for issues involving both assemblies, the University calls on the Joint Committee of the Board and Senate

Bicameralism is used by most of Canada's universities because it not only recognizes the need for sound administrative practices, but also defers to the judgement of the proper authorities in academic matters per se.
